Abstract
501,328. Testing physical qualities of materials. BOSCH GES., R. Aug. 6, 1938, No. 23154. Convention date, Aug. 5, 1937. [Class 106 (ii)] Apparatus for testing torsional endurance wherein test-rods are clamped fast at one end and are moved to and fro by levers or the like at the other end, comprises a device wherein a number of test-rods 4 are disposed in parallel relationship with one end 3 of each clamped at 2, while the other ends 7 which are revolubly mounted at 9, carry levers 8 of different lengths, such levers being connected to a common reciprocating driving rod 17 or like means so that the test-rods are rocked to different angular extents. In Fig. 1, the levers 8 are provided with toothed segments which gear with the toothed rod 17 which is reciprocated by adjustable crank and link mechanism 19, 20 from a motor 18. The clamps and bearings for the rods are mounted on supports 21 at different heights above the base 1. In a modification, the rod 17 is not toothed and is a double rod having depending from each side a series of slotted arms along which may be clamped adjustable pins adapted to work in slotted arms or levers attached to the rocking ends of the test rods. The ends of the reciprocating rod or beam are carried by the upper ends of equal and parallel spring strips attached to the base.
